Kenneth Name Meaning

The name Kenneth is a Scottish name, derived from the Gaelic name “Coinneach,” which means “handsome.” It was popularized in the English-speaking world by the Scottish king Kenneth MacAlpin in the 9th century.

Origins of the Name Kenneth

Over time, the name Kenneth has evolved and spread in usage, with variations appearing in different cultures, including the Irish name Cionaith and the Welsh name Cenydd.

Despite its Scottish origins, the name Kenneth has become a popular name all over the world, particularly in English-speaking countries. In the United States, it was a top 100 name for much of the 20th century and remained a popular choice for boys well into the 1980s.

Popularity of the Name Kenneth

In the early 1900s, Kenneth was a popular name for boys in the United States and remained so for several decades. Its popularity reached its peak in the 1930s, 1940s, and 1950s, when it was among the top 10 names for boys in the country.

However, its popularity began to decline in the 1960s and 1970s, and by the 1980s, it had fallen out of the top 100 names for boys. Despite this decline, the name has remained a popular choice for parents, particularly in the English-speaking world.

Famous Kenneths

Throughout history, there have been many notable people named Kenneth, including kings, politicians, actors, and athletes. Some of the most famous Kenneths include:

  • Kenneth Branagh, a British actor, director, and writer
  • Kenneth Clarke, a British politician and former cabinet minister
  • Kenneth Cole, an American fashion designer
  • Kenneth Kaunda, the first president of Zambia
  • Kenneth More, a British actor
